About This Plant
Ruellia brittoniana'Pink Katie' Ruellia brittoniana 'Pink Katie' is very similar in appearances to Ruellia brittoniana 'Katie'. The main difference is the flower color is pink instead of purple. Pink Katie will reach a height of only 12 inches which makes this a good variety for layering in front of taller plants in the water garden. Ruellia brittoniana 'Pink Katie' flowers continuously throughout the summer months adding a bright spot to any pond or water feature. A great marginal plant it can also be used outside of the water garden so don't be afraid to experiment with different ideas.
